Advanced Direct RF Processing modules leveraging Intel’s Agilex 9 Direct RF-Series field programmable gate array (FPGA). Enabling direct digitisation and processing of wideband RF Signals, the AGRW014 device integrates 4 Rx and 4 Tx channels, with a sampling rate of 64GSPS, with 10 bit resolution and an RF input bandwidth of 32GHz..

The DRF2580 is a high-performance System on Module (SoM) based on the Intel Agilex™ 9 SoC FPGA AGRW014 device.

The DRF4580L is a rugged, Small-Form Factor module based on the Intel Agilex™ 9 SoC FPGA AGRW014 device.

Product Name: DRF2580

Description

The DRF2580 has been designed to bring direct RF performance to a wide range of different applications by offering the FPGA in a small System-on-Module (SoM) solution measuring only 2.5 inches by 3.5 inches.

  • Four 10-bit ADC channels and four 10-bit DAC channels
  • Sampling Rate: 64 Gsps
  • RF Input Bandwidth: Up to 32 GHz
  • Intel Agilex 9® SoC FPGA - AGRW014
  • 16 GB of DDR4 SDRAM
  • GT connections for gigabit serial communication
  • Ruggedized and conduction-cooled versions available

Product Name: DRF4580L

Description

The DRF4580L is a high-performance, Small Form Factor module measuring only 6.4 inches by 6.4 inches by 1.7 inches, for use in a range of environments that can't be satisfied with traditional board/chassis deployment.

  • Four 10-bit ADC channels and four 10-bit DAC channels
  • Sampling Rate: 64 Gsps
  • RF Input Bandwidth: Up to 32 GHz
  • Intel Agilex 9® SoC FPGA - AGRW014
  • 16 GB of DDR4 SDRAM
  • Four 100 GigE UDP interfaces (Optical QFSP28)
  • GPIO (LVDS 11 Pairs)
  • Ruggedized and conduction-cooled
